Ashley A. Walter is a scholar working on Orthopedics and Sports Medicine, Biomedical Engineering and Physiology. According to data from OpenAlex, Ashley A. Walter has authored 42 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 22 papers in Orthopedics and Sports Medicine, 15 papers in Biomedical Engineering and 12 papers in Physiology. Recurrent topics in Ashley A. Walter's work include Sports Performance and Training (19 papers), Sports injuries and prevention (13 papers) and Muscle activation and electromyography studies (12 papers). Ashley A. Walter is often cited by papers focused on Sports Performance and Training (19 papers), Sports injuries and prevention (13 papers) and Muscle activation and electromyography studies (12 papers). Ashley A. Walter collaborates with scholars based in United States, Australia and Denmark. Ashley A. Walter's co-authors include Joel T. Cramer, Jeffrey R. Stout, Trent J. Herda, Abbie E. Smith‐Ryan, Pablo B. Costa, Eric D. Ryan, Travis W. Beck, Jordan R. Moon, Katherine M. Hoge and C M Lockwood and has published in prestigious journals such as Journal of Clinical Oncology, Medicine & Science in Sports & Exercise and British Journal Of Nutrition.
